Jefferson Youth Soccer & New York Red Bulls Team up

By Sean McCaffery, June 26, 2020

The NJ team has just entered into an agreement for a youth training partnership with Jefferson. They will give to them a full system to develop the youth player with totally dedicated RB coaching staff, cirriculum access to the Red Print way, high quality team training, extra clinics, coaching education workshops & seasonal training camps. Jefferson is a NFP, volunteer driven group giving chances to their Township residents from 3-17. Their charge is to push the game in the Township and to motivate sportsmanship and long term youth player development. In addition they are set on developing coaches that are driven and youth officials to add to their program with the goal of  geting young players safe, community-based surroundings and understand playing the game from a technical and tactical standpoint as they acquire much need life skills via their presence in sport and sporting groups.

Grant FIndlay, Regional Manager informed "We are truly excited about welcoming the players and teams from Jefferson Youth Soccer to the Red Bulls family.

Jefferson Club Pres. Elen Barlow added " We are thrilled to begin a partnership with the New York Red Bulls. All of our players will have the opportunity to work with the Red Bulls coaching staff.
